Mark Stephen Roth (April 10, 1951 – November 26, 2024) was an American professional bowler. He won 34 PBA Tour titles in his career (sixth most all-time), and is a member of the PBA and USBC Halls of Fame. WebJun 13, 2006 · Roth once slam-dunked a 16-pound ball into a floor. He once kicked a ball into a bay.
